ABSTRACT

BACKGROUND: This study aimed to determine the clinical and radiological course in children who had Legg-Calvé-Perthes disease (LCPD) associated with juvenile idiopathic arthritis (JIA). METHODS: In a retrospective chart review between 2007 and 2019, eight consecutive JIA patients diagnosed with concomitant LCPD were identified and compared with a case-control group of 10 children with LCPD only. RESULTS: LCPD was diagnosed at a mean age of 8.1 years (3.0-14.7) in children with JIA as compared to 6.1 years (2.9-10.0) in controls. According to the modified Harris Hip Score (mHHS), four children with JIA and all controls had an excellent result. Regarding the fragmentation severity and the duration of each stage, we found no differences using the lateral pillar and modified Elizabethtown classification. Five hips were classified as Stulberg I/II, two hips as Stulberg III, and one hip as Stulberg V with no evidence of hip dysplasia or severe overcoverage in either group. CONCLUSIONS: The radiological outcome of LCPD did not differ between both groups, while the clinical outcome was slightly better in controls. Physicians should be aware that children with LCPD may have JIA too. In suspicious cases, further investigations are recommended, and patients should be referred to pediatric rheumatologists.

ABSTRACT

INTRODUCTION: Tibial plateau fractures are common fractures in adults and can be extremely challenging for surgeons. State-of-the-art therapy is open reduction and internal fixation (ORIF), although major complications of ORIF are surgical site infections (SSIs). This is especially critical on the proximal tibia, which is only sparsely covered by soft tissue and has a close relation to the knee joint. We analyzed SSIs after ORIF to correlate established laboratory parameters to the occurrence of SSIs. METHODS: A monocentric case-control study in a Level 1 Trauma Center was conducted. Data were acquired from electronic medical records from 2011 until 2016. White blood cell count (WBC) and C-reactive protein (CRP) were used as laboratory parameters and statistically analyzed. RESULTS: In total, 97 patients were included, with four patients suffering from SSIs. Patients with SSIs had a significantly increased WBC count and CRP levels on the third postoperative day. Infection was diagnosed after rehospitalization, 12 ± 4 weeks after initial surgery. Furthermore, a large bony destruction through trauma coincides with a rise of WBC count with no influence on CRP level. CONCLUSION: We highly recommend a laboratory analysis with WBC count and CRP on the third day after ORIF. Patients with a CRP level above 100 mg/l should be closely watched, even if laboratory parameters few days later are adequate-since a one-time increase above this landmark might be a hint regarding the development of a SSI.
